Women's Challenger Series Final Rankings
Last updated on December 6, 2021
Notes:
1) The top 6, non-CT women from the 2021 Challengers Series qualified for the 2022 Championship Tour.
2) Luana Silva wins the tiebreaker (best two event results) over Molly Picklum for the sixth and final CT qualification spot.
